Good Web Game engine that is an implementation of a web compatible subset of the ggez game engine constructed on top of miniquad.

Good Web Game: This is a subset of the ggez game engine in browsers. For example, the game 'Dig Escape' was made in ggez at the start and was then ported to work on the browser using this engine.
